Antenna design, starting from scratch, using full wave analysis software can become a very time-consuming task. Using analytical (approximate) antenna models, especially at the initial stage, can reduce the overall design time considerably, as is shown in this paper. To help antenna designers, a list of common antenna types and the accompanying models is given. Two of the models have not been published, in the current form, before.
